Uluwatu

Let’s start the list with the location of majestic clifftops overlooking the Indian Ocean. Uluwatu is part of the Bukit Peninsula, which offers some of the best beaches and luxurious villas and venues on the island. If the idea of tying the knot over a gorgeous clifftop with Bali’s iconic sunset views and the sound of crashing waves below is what you got in mind, then look no further than Uluwatu.

  • Pros: Stunning view of the Indian Ocean with Bali’s most luxurious villas.
  • Cons: Can get very windy & villas can get too pricey.

Ubud

If you’re looking for a more traditional and less touristy wedding destination, then the popular Ubud might be the authentic Balinese wedding spot for you. Located in the quieter inland of Bali, Ubud gives that alluring and exotic feel of classic Bali surrounded by tropical green jungles, natural waterfalls, and emerald green rice paddies. The villas and venues at Ubud will make your wedding look like something out of a Hollywood movie.

  • Pros: Perfect for traditional Balinese wedding vibes
  • Cons: Located far from major entertainment areas. The shops, restaurants & bars close relatively earlier compared to other areas of Bali.

Tabanan

Located in the island’s unspoiled center, Tabanan has some of the best views of rice terraces in Bali, which are protected by UNESCO as a world heritage site along with beautiful beaches without the overflowing tourists. It is the perfect choice if you prioritize a peaceful and tranquil wedding far away from any hustle and bustle of the city center.

  • Pros: Best view of rice fields in Bali.
  • Cons: Similar to Ubud, Tabanan is even further away from any entertainment hubs. Resorts and villas are usually far away from each other, so it can get very quiet, especially during the night.

Sanur

Known as the sunrise beach, Sanur is a smaller, quieter, and more relaxed beachside compared to Kuta. The 9km stretch of coastline is lined by five-star hotels, endless choice of luxury villas while still manage to preserve its white sand beach and Balinese essence. While weddings in Sanur beach may not be the most private choice as both tourists and locals will likely watch your ceremony in their bathing suits, the northern Sanur offers plenty of secluded beach villas with luxurious poolside gardens and magical views of sailboats facing the horizon.

  • Pros: a calm beachside with plenty of cheap venues.
  • Cons: Don’t expect total privacy, as Sanur is filled with elderly tourists and locals usually perform their sacred ceremonies at the beachside.

Nusa Dua

With award-winning tropical gardens, some of the most luxurious hotels in Asia, and its convenient distance to the airport, Nusa Dua has grown into a popular entertainment center for tourists worldwide. If a resort wedding is what you had in mind, then Nusa Dua won’t disappoint you! Its white sand beach is well maintained and safe for children with clean water perfect for a quiet stroll before or after your big day.

  • Pros: Convenient location, ideal for a comfort wedding with complete amenities.
  • Cons: As Nusa Dua has become one of Indonesia’s convention center for international conferences, a wedding here may seem a little too formal.

Beratan Lake

Thinking of a wedding outside of the beach and rice fields? How about saying “I do” on a canoe in the middle of a Lake? Located high up in the mountains, the lakeside of Beratan offers you an exclusive lakeside wedding surrounded by green gardens and cool temperature of 20o C. After the event, you’ll spend the night in a luxurious villa with some of the best mountain views on the island, now that’s a romantic start!

  • Pros: Unique wedding experience out of the usual beach & rice fields.
  • Cons: Not suitable if you’re not into cold places.

Kuta

When it comes to entertainment in Bali, Kuta is the naughtiest coastal town known as one of the world’s liveliest and best-value hangouts spots. The stretch of 3-km beachfront road is lined with fancy restaurants, shopping malls, luxury resorts, and clubs. Kuta can be a fun choice for young couples and guests who choose to stay in an inclusive resort and looking for some crazy nights after your ceremony.

  • Pros: Plenty of choice for luxury villas, shopping malls best entertainment in Bali. Also good for catching the tropical sunset.
  • Cons: Kuta is always loud, hyper touristy and overcrowded and is generally less suited for weddings as very few venues exist.

Seminyak

Known as the funky corner of Bali, Seminyak has grown into a stylish district with classy restaurants and lounge bars. The beach is less crowded compared to Kuta’s and is perfect for couples who seek a casual wedding than the big fancy ones. With some of the best sunsets and cocktails on the island, Seminyak will be a fine treat for you and your guests.

  • Pros: A dynamic, funky side of Bali with star hotels and affordable small villas and resorts.
  • Cons: Most of the villas are too small and are not recommended for weddings with large guest numbers.

Canggu

Canggu earned the name “the sleepy surfer town” offers visitors the perfect balance of convenience and comfort, with occasional rice fields and serene stretches of shoreline. If you’re looking for a villa wedding, you’ll find better options in north Canggu alongside its coastal environment with views of the seaside panoramas and backdropped by romantic sunsets. Perfect for an evening stroll with a Bintang after the ceremony!

  • Pros: Canggu offers better options for villa weddings than Kuta/Seminyak
  • Cons: Large wedding celebrations might disturb the expats living in the area.

Candi Dasa – Eastern Bali

Remote areas in Bali gives the sense of escape into the untouched regions of Bali. However, if you’re looking at these places for your wedding, keep in mind that there are extremely limited options of villas, hotels, and resorts that offer the service. Candi Dasa in eastern Bali has few options for weddings in the form of small homestay resorts to a handful of luxury villas and hotels.

  • Pros: One of the few “hidden gems” of Bali, suitable for adventurous couples looking for a wedding.
  • Cons: Getting married off the beaten tracks is usually not advisable.
